Освоение преобразования BMP в TEX с использованием GroupDocs.Conversion для .NET

Откройте для себя всю мощь преобразования документов: конвертируйте изображения BMP в формат TEX с легкостью

Введение

В сегодняшнюю цифровую эпоху эффективное управление файлами и конвертация имеют решающее значение. Независимо от того, являетесь ли вы разработчиком, стремящимся оптимизировать свой рабочий процесс, или предприятием, стремящимся оптимизировать обработку документов, овладение конвертацией файлов может значительно повысить производительность. В этом руководстве основное внимание уделяется конвертации изображений BMP в формат TEX с использованием мощной библиотеки GroupDocs.Conversion для .NET.

Основные выводы:

  • Понять важность преобразования файлов в управлении данными
  • Узнайте, как настроить и использовать библиотеку GroupDocs.Conversion для .NET
  • Следуйте пошаговым инструкциям по конвертации файлов BMP в формат TEX.
  • Изучите реальные приложения и возможности интеграции с другими системами

К концу этого руководства вы будете вооружены навыками, необходимыми для внедрения эффективных преобразований документов в ваших проектах. Давайте начнем с рассмотрения предварительных условий.

Предпосылки

Прежде чем приступить к процессу конвертации, убедитесь, что у вас есть следующее:

Требуемые библиотеки, версии и зависимости

  • GroupDocs.Конвертация для .NET версия 25.3.0

Требования к настройке среды

  • Среда разработки, совместимая с .NET (например, Visual Studio)
  • Базовые знания программирования на C#

Необходимые знания

  • Знакомство с путями к файлам и их обработкой в приложениях .NET

Настройка GroupDocs.Conversion для .NET

Для начала установите библиотеку GroupDocs.Conversion с помощью консоли диспетчера пакетов NuGet или .NET CLI.

Консоль менеджера пакетов NuGet:

Install-Package GroupDocs.Conversion -Version 25.3.0

.NET CLI:

dotnet add package GroupDocs.Conversion --version 25.3.0

Этапы получения лицензии

  1. Бесплатная пробная версия: Начните с загрузки пробной версии с сайта Бесплатная пробная версия GroupDocs.
  2. Временная лицензия: Для расширенного доступа подайте заявку на временную лицензию по адресу Временная лицензия GroupDocs.
  3. Покупка: Для долгосрочного использования приобретите полную версию у Покупка GroupDocs.

Базовая инициализация и настройка

Вот как инициализировать и настроить GroupDocs.Conversion в вашем проекте .NET:

using System;
using GroupDocs.Conversion;

class Program
{
    static void Main()
    {
        // Инициализируйте объект Converter с исходным путем к файлу BMP.
        using (var converter = new GroupDocs.Conversion.Converter("YOUR_DOCUMENT_DIRECTORY/sample.bmp"))
        {
            Console.WriteLine("Converter initialized successfully!");
        }
    }
}

В этом фрагменте мы инициализируем Converter класс с файлом BMP для настройки нашей среды конвертации.

Руководство по внедрению

Теперь, когда все настроено, приступим к конвертации файлов BMP в формат TEX.

Конвертировать файл BMP в формат TEX

Эта функция использует GroupDocs.Conversion для бесшовного преобразования изображений BMP в документы TEX.

Загрузите исходный файл BMP

Сначала загрузите ваш BMP-файл с помощью Converter класс. Этот шаг инициализирует процесс преобразования:

using (var converter = new GroupDocs.Conversion.Converter(inputFile))
{
    // Логика преобразования идет здесь
}

Установить параметры преобразования для формата TEX

Далее определите формат вывода, настроив PageDescriptionLanguageConvertOptions:

PageDescriptionLanguageConvertOptions options = new PageDescriptionLanguageConvertOptions { Format = PageDescriptionLanguageFileType.Tex };

The options.Format Параметр указывает, что мы конвертируем в TEX. Он управляет процессом конвертации.

Конвертировать и сохранить

Наконец, выполните преобразование и сохраните результат:

converter.Convert(outputFile, options);

Этот метод преобразует файл BMP в формат TEX и сохраняет его в указанном месте.

Советы по устранению неполадок

  • Распространенная проблема: Если преобразование не удалось, убедитесь, что путь к входному BMP-файлу указан правильно.
  • Совет по повышению производительности: Для больших файлов следите за системными ресурсами, чтобы избежать проблем с памятью.

Практические применения

GroupDocs.Conversion для .NET предлагает разнообразные приложения:

  1. Автоматизация документооборота: Интегрируйте преобразования BMP в TEX в автоматизированные системы генерации отчетов.
  2. Архивирование проектов: Конвертируйте визуальные ресурсы в текстовые форматы для эффективного архивирования и поиска.
  3. Образовательные инструменты: Используется в образовательном программном обеспечении для преобразования диаграмм или изображений в редактируемые текстовые документы.

Соображения производительности

Для оптимальной производительности:

  • Управляйте использованием памяти, оперативно удаляя объекты. using заявления.
  • Контролируйте процесс конвертации больших файлов, чтобы обеспечить стабильность системы.

Лучшие практики

  • Регулярно обновляйте свою библиотеку, чтобы воспользоваться улучшениями производительности и исправлениями ошибок.
  • Тестируйте преобразования в контролируемой среде перед их внедрением в производственные системы.

Заключение

Теперь вы освоили преобразование изображений BMP в формат TEX с помощью GroupDocs.Conversion для .NET. Этот навык расширяет ваши возможности обработки документов и сферу применения, которые вы можете разрабатывать.

Следующие шаги

Рассмотрите возможность изучения других форматов конвертации, поддерживаемых GroupDocs.Conversion, и интеграции их в свои проекты для еще большей функциональности.

Раздел часто задаваемых вопросов

В1: Могу ли я конвертировать файлы BMP в несколько документов TEX? A1: Да, путем итерации по коллекции файлов BMP и применения логики преобразования по отдельности.

В2: Какие существуют альтернативы GroupDocs.Conversion для .NET? A2: Альтернативными вариантами являются Aspose.Words и iTextSharp, хотя они могут не предлагать такой же набор форматов или не быть такими простыми в использовании.

В3: Как обрабатывать ошибки во время конвертации? A3: Реализуйте блоки try-catch вокруг вашей логики преобразования, чтобы изящно управлять исключениями.

В4: Возможно ли пакетное преобразование файлов с помощью GroupDocs.Conversion для .NET? A4: Да, путем циклического просмотра каталога файлов BMP и последовательного преобразования каждого из них.

В5: Какие ограничения по размеру файла следует учитывать при конвертации с помощью GroupDocs.Conversion? A5: Хотя строгих ограничений по размеру нет, для больших файлов может потребоваться больше памяти и вычислительной мощности.

Ресурсы

Следуя этому руководству, вы будете хорошо подготовлены к внедрению и оптимизации преобразований BMP в TEX в ваших проектах. Удачного кодирования!